Automatic Transmission Technology (Word count: 300) Modern automatic cars utilize advanced transmission technology to effortlessly change gear ratios, freeing drivers from the manual intervention required in traditional cars. There are three primary types of automatic transmission technology found in modern vehicles:
Continuously Variable Transmission (CVT): CVT allows for seamless gear shifting by using a belt and pulley system, providing a smooth acceleration experience without distinct gear changes.
Automated Manual Transmission (AMT): AMT combines the benefits of both manual and automatic transmissions. While it operates as a manual transmission, the gear shifting is automated, ...
... eliminating the need for a clutch pedal.
Dual-Clutch Automated Manual: This advanced technology utilizes two clutches to pre-select the next gear, resulting in faster and smoother gear changes. It offers improved performance and efficiency, often found in high-end sports cars.
Essential Tips for Driving an Automatic Car (Word count: 900) To optimize your driving experience in an automatic car, it is essential to follow these key tips:
Don't shift to N when in motion: It is crucial to avoid shifting the gear to neutral (N) while the vehicle is in motion. Doing so can place unnecessary strain on the transmission system, leading to increased wear and tear. Only shift to neutral when the car has come to a complete stop.
Use handbrake and park mode: Automatic cars are equipped with a park mode (P) for a reason. Always engage the park mode when parking the vehicle and remember to apply the handbrake. Neglecting to use the handbrake places excessive pressure on the transmission mechanism. For AMT cars, keep the shifter in neutral mode and utilize the handbrake, as they lack a dedicated park mode.
Don't use your left foot: Unlike manual cars, automatic cars only require two pedals, rendering the clutch pedal unnecessary. Avoid the common mistake of using both feet while driving an automatic car. This practice can lead to unintended acceleration and braking simultaneously, compromising control and safety. Thus, refrain from using your left foot while driving an automatic car.
